Avocado-Nut Bread
0 Likes
Prep Time:
15 minutes
Cook Time:
60 minutes
Total Time:
85 minutes
Avocado-infused quick bread, moist and decadent with a taste reminiscent of banana-nut bread.
Ingredients:
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up low-calorie natural sweetener (such as Swerve®)
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.75 cup mashed Haas avocado
  • 0.75 cup buttermilk
  • 1 egg, at room temperature
  • 0.5 cup chopped pecans
Instructions:
  • Preheat your o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) and generously grease a 9x5-inch loaf pan.
  • In a bowl, combine flour, sweetener, baking powder, cinnamon, baking soda, and salt, then sift; set aside.
  • Combine ripe avocado, creamy buttermilk, a fresh egg, and aromatic vanilla in a separate bowl, stirring until well blended. Incorporate the dry ingredients into the mixture, being careful not to overmix. Gently fold in the chopped pecans before pouring the batter into the prepared pan.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 60 to 75 minutes until a toothpick comes out clean. Let it c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then invert onto a wire rack to cool completely before slicing.
